The first few days we will be in London then we move on to Greece to begin our Contiki "Spotlight on Greece" which will include stops in Athens, Delphi, and my personal favourite - OLYMPIA! Then we move on the Mykonos. We will be staying at the Contiki Resort for 4 days then we will be going back to Athens for one more day. At this point we will all be going our separate ways. Some people are flying back home to Calgary 2 days after Greece, some people are visiting friends and relatives around Europe, some are visiting the Scandinavian countries, and some are visiting popular destinations such as Paris.

Andrea and myself will be flying from Athens to Rome to explore the "Eternal City" and of course visit the Pope. It is not very likely that we will be witnessing any gladiator fights - but we will still enjoying seeing the Colosseum up close and personal!

From Rome we will travel to Venice and from Venice we will leave passionate Italy and travel north to Austria. Salzburg will be our one and only stop in this beautiful country but we intend to make the most of it. We, of course, will be going on a "Sound of Music" tour - which is something that I am looking forward to the most! We will also be visiting Mozart's home while we are there as well.

Leaving Salzburg on an overnight train we will be moving on to "The City of Light"! Paris, of course! At this time we may be meeting up with some friends from school to spend two and a half days exploring the French Capital and all it has to offer!

From Paris we return to London for one night before we begin our journey home to Calgary! I'm sure we will be lacking in sleep but will have many stories to tell! This covers just the basics of my adventure that still awaits me - so stay tuned!
